Motivation • Large number of government organizations / NGOs / Academic Institutions • Minimal penetration of GIS at operational level • Imported software too expensive, lacking support, and time consuming for manpower training • Government of India sponsored development of in-house GIS development

  3. An Indigenous GIS tool for windows • GRAM++ (Geo Referenced Area Management) – A GIS tool • GRAM++ built with Object Oriented Approach • Works for both Vector and Raster data formats • A Windows Software Product

  5. Modular Architecture • Data preparation • Vector Data Analysis • Raster Data Analysis • Map Visualization

  6. List of Modules of GRAM++ Data Preparation • Input Output: The Input/Output module gives the facility to import/Export data with other formats from/into GRAM++ Vector and Raster format. • Map Edit: This module provides facility for digitization / vectorisation of map on the screen along with Projection selection and convertion

  9. List of Modules Contd... Vector Data Analysis • Vector Analysis: The Vector Analysis module gives the facility to query the map, generate various thematic and statistical maps • TIN: The GRAM++-TIN module allows to triangulate GRAM++ Vector point format data. It can also generate contours from Triangulated data. • GRAMNet: GRAMNet module, basically is a Network Analysis module. It has functionalities of finding shortest distance between a source node and the destination node, solve Location Allocation problem. • Statistics: The statistical module help the interpretation of the data information collected. The data / information may be spatial or non spatial.

  14. List of Modules Contd... Raster Data Analysis • Raster Analysis: The Raster Analysis module has functions of arithmetic operations(like addition, subtraction etc), regrouping (class and range), Buffering, Zonal , Focal, Watershed Delineation etc. • Terrain: The Terrain module provides facility for generation of DTM from contour map and calculation of slope, aspect and generates • Image Processing: Image processing has functions to perform the operations such as Image Enhancement, Image Classification, and Image Transformation.

  18. List of Modules Contd... Visualizer • Vector Layout: This module provides facility for visualising vector maps in 2D and 3D with the various layout features such as North arrow, Scale bar, Legends. • Raster Layout: This module provides facility for visualising raster maps in 2Dand 3D.It also provides several other integrated raster utilities such as North arrow. Online Help • Online Help: Keeping in view the types of users GRAM++, a detailed online help is provided for each function

GRAM++ GIS - Present status • GRAM++ GIS is presently being distributed, maintained and upgraded by an IIT incubatee BHUGOL GIS Pvt Ltd. via technology transfer • Within a short span of distribution GRAM++ has a rich user base in all the sectors (Educational/Government/NGO’s/Commercial) across India • Based on today's need and on the basis of GRAM++ Bhugol GIS has developed a web based GIS server software named WebGRAMServer (www.webgramserver.com)

Functionalities of WebGRAMServer (WGS) • WGS enable organizations to publish and share geographic data, maps, and • analyses over web • Web Gram Server is a server-based geographic information system (GIS) • It comes with web based services for spatial data management, • visualization, and spatial analysis along with publishing the maps over the web

  24. List of Functionalities of WGS • Publish various map layers over the Web • Multiple layer view • Change the layer color, style and thickness for Point, Segment and Polygon type layers • Zoom in/Zoom Out/Fit to window • Panning • Info tool • Non-Spatial query and spatial query using one or data from multiple layers. • Thematic Mapping with single field • Thematic Mapping with two field • Class based/Range based classification

  25. List of Functionalities of WGS • Dot Density based classification • Symbol based classification • Comparison the fields using Pie Chart representation • Database display • Highlighting feature from selected record • Applying transparency to the layer
